95 A6 Quattro HVAC and transmission problems

I have a 1995 A6 Quattro with a 2.8. Two different problems appeared more or less simultaneously. The HVAC quit working, totally dead, wont turn on. The transmission makes a horrible screeching when shifted into park or neutral, it is OK when you start it, but once you shift into another gear and then shift back to P or N it screeches. I looked up wiring diagrams for the HVAC and trans control systems and don't see any common grounds. What am I missing here?
